System Context

55 Cnc B c orbits 55 Cnc B and was reported in 2025 and was detected with the Radial Velocity method.

Published measurements list a minimum mass of 5.3 Earth masses (M sin i) and an orbital period of 33.75 days.

Catalog data places the system at about 12.5 parsecs from Earth, a host star classified as M4.5 V, and 7 known planets in the system.
